epilogue Meaning
epilogue (n)
a short speech (often in verse) addressed directly to the audience by an actor at the end of a play
a short passage added at the end of a literary work
epilogue (n.)
A speech or short poem addressed to the spectators and recited by one of the actors, after the conclusion of the play.
The closing part of a discourse, in which the principal matters are recapitulated; a conclusion.
